Meaning Making

Finding purpose, significance, or value in adversity and suffering.

Meaning Making is the process of finding purpose, significance, or value in adversity and suffering. It helps individuals navigate difficult experiences by attributing deeper meaning to them, which can provide a sense of control and resilience. This dynamic often develops as a way to cope with trauma or significant life challenges, allowing people to integrate these experiences into their personal narrative without being overwhelmed. Drawing from existential psychology and philosophy, Meaning Making is a powerful tool for emotional regulation and growth.
